In a major step, Miss Teen USA gets rid of its swimsuit competitionThe organizers of the Miss Teen USA pageant announced a major change Wednesday — the pageant, which features competitors between the ages of 15 and 19, will scrap the swimsuit portion of the competition in favor of a more body-positive clothing segment.

“Worrying Signs” shows the atmosphere of hate in the U.K. post BrexitHate speech against minorities appears to be on the rise in the wake of the Brexit.With that in mind, Sarah Childs, Natasha Blank and Yasmin Weaver created a Facebook photo album of screenshots revealing incidents of hate titled “Worrying Signs.“One woman recounted the horrifying story of being approached at a London bar by a middle-aged white man.
